446 ; rv40_weight_func_%1(uint8_t *dst, uint8_t *src1, uint8_t *src2, int w1, int w2, int stride)
447 ; %1=size %2=num of xmm regs
448 ; The weights are FP0.14 notation of fractions depending on pts.
449 ; For timebases without rounding error (i.e. PAL), the fractions
450 ; can be simplified, and several operations can be avoided.
451 ; Therefore, we check here whether they are multiples of 2^9 for
452 ; those simplifications to occur.
